Local tips
- Visit early in the morning to avoid crowds and fully enjoy the beauty of Zócalo.
- Check the calendar for cultural events or festivals that often take place in the square.
- Try local street food like tacos or churros from vendors around the area.
- Wear comfortable shoes, as you'll be doing a lot of walking on cobblestone streets.
- Take a guided tour to learn more about the rich history and stories behind the landmarks.

Getting There
-
Walking
If you are near the Palacio de Bellas Artes, head east on Avenida Juárez towards Eje Central Lázaro Cárdenas. Continue straight until you reach the Zócalo, which is the main square of Centro Histórico. The Centro de la CDMX is located at the Zócalo, so just follow the crowds and signs pointing you to this central landmark.
-
Metro
If you are near a Metro station, take Line 2 (Blue Line) and get off at the 'Zócalo/Tenochtitlan' station. Once you exit the station, follow the signs guiding you to the Zócalo. The Centro de la CDMX is directly in front of you as you emerge from the station. Metro rides cost 5 MXN.
-
Public Bus
Look for a bus stop where you can catch a bus heading towards Centro Histórico. Buses frequently pass by and you can ask the driver to let you off at the Zócalo. The bus fare is usually around 6 MXN. Once you get off, walk towards the Zócalo, which is a large open square and hard to miss.
